I don't want to do my SERVICE HOURS



At WTPL we ask for a Service Hour committment from each family.  Each family is required to work 10 hours of service.  You can work in the concession stand, scorekeeping or field maintanence.  Anyone over the age of 16 is able to work and get credited for the service hours.  So if you are working in the concession, bring in your brother, sister, aunt or uncle and get credit for the time.

If you don't want to work your hours you can do one of two things:

1)  Pay $5 for every uncompleted hour.  This must be paid by May 20th.

or

2)  Purchase 20oz bottle of Gatorade.  You must purchase a total of 72 bottles ~ 3 cases of 24 ~ 4 packs of 18 each ~ 6 packs of 12 each.  Must turn in no later than Saturday, March 10th.

Kids Sports Network Clinic - Certification Class

Just a reminder to all COACHES, TEAM MOMS and any Interested Parents that are wanting to assist in coaching that the certification class will be on Wednesday, February 9, 2011 at 6pm at John Jay High School Cafeteria.

All coaches that were certified last year through KSN just need to come in and pay $20 for your certification and take your picture for your badge. 

If you participated in another sport through the KSN program, ie Spurs Drug Free Basketball League, then your certication is ~$10.

If this is the first time you are being certified through KSN for Westwood Terrace Pony League, then please be prepared to stay for the entire class, ~ til 9pm.

If you are unable to attend Wednesday's class, please go to the web site link and find another day for you to attend.  Certification must be completed by March 12th.
